Ticker impact
Evercore downgraded Sun Life Financial to Inline, citing valuation upside tapped out and messy operational friction across segments.
Near-term downside bias; expect volatility around analyst-follow-through and any subsequent company updates.
The article provides a clear rating change plus a specific target, with a detailed thesis (valuation, operational friction, regulatory fog).
Mizuho downgraded Circle Internet Group to Underperform, arguing Open USD’s model will compress stablecoin interest margins and cut 2027 EBITDA.
Downward pressure likely, especially if traders treat the EBITDA compression as a credible read-across to margins.
The text includes a concrete target cut ($85 to $50) and a quantified EBITDA estimate reduction (25% below consensus).
BofA downgraded StoneCo to Neutral, cutting 2026-2027 earnings estimates on Brazil’s higher-for-longer rates raising funding costs and credit provisions.
Moderate bearish bias; stock may lag peers until rate/credit trends stabilize.
The article cites specific estimate cuts (9% and 13%) and a thesis tied to loan growth and asset-quality deterioration risk.
BTIG downgraded Etsy to Neutral after a 55% YTD rally, saying short covering and rotation out of AI tech drove price beyond fundamental growth limits.
Limited upside near-term; potential for mean reversion if the rally was sentiment-led.
The article provides a clear rating change and valuation framing (11x 2027 adjusted EBITDA vs Amazon), but no new Etsy operational datapoint.
Goldman Sachs downgraded Regions Financial to Neutral, pointing to buybacks collapsing and trimmed guidance implying margin weakness despite a bare-minimum quarter.
Near-term weakness risk, particularly if traders extrapolate margin pressure from the guidance tweak and buyback drop.
The text includes specific buyback figures ($59M vs $401M) and a target ($36), with a concrete thesis about operational upside being absent.
Market effects
Rate sensitivity and credit-quality concerns are reinforced for fintech/lending models (Stone) and bank margin/capital-return narratives (Regions).
Brazil high-for-longer rates are highlighted as a direct risk driver for StoneCo’s credit and funding economics.
Stablecoin competitive dynamics (Circle vs Open USD) underscore broader crypto-adjacent payments yield compression risk.
Counterpoint
Analyst downgrades may overstate near-term fundamentals; some changes are valuation and positioning-driven (Etsy) or model-based (Circle’s EBITDA compression).
